Brooklyn Bridge

Your adventure begins with a spin around the Brooklyn Bridge, an engineering marvel from 1870 that still captures the imagination. While you won’t be walking across it, you’ll get a chance to appreciate its Gothic towers and sweeping cables from the comfort of your taxi. Knowing it was one of the world’s first suspension bridges adds a special touch—this is the kind of landmark that embodies New York’s pioneering spirit.

South Street Seaport

Next, you’ll glide past the South Street Seaport, a historic district with cobblestone streets and a collection of impressively large ships docked along the waterfront. It’s a lively mix of old-world charm and modern revitalization, perfect for snapping photos and imagining the days when sailing ships carried goods into Manhattan.

Manhattan Bridge

Cruising under the Manhattan Bridge, you’ll experience a different perspective of the city’s skyline—over 350,000 commuters use this bridge daily, connecting Manhattan to Brooklyn. Guides often share stories about the bridge’s construction and its role as a vital artery for the city.

Little Italy

In Little Italy, you’ll explore a neighborhood dense with history and culture, home to over 20 historic landmarks. The lively streets offer a taste of Italy right in the heart of Manhattan, with plenty of photo opportunities and a sense of stepping into another world.

Chinatown

From there, you’ll venture into Chinatown, where the largest Chinese community in North America resides. Your guide will likely highlight some of the area’s rich heritage, bustling streets, and perhaps suggest where you might find authentic dim sum or unique souvenirs if you decide to explore on your own afterward.

Neighborhoods of West Village, SoHo, and TriBeCa

Finally, your tour takes you through some of Manhattan’s trendiest neighborhoods. The West Village feels like a quaint, tree-lined escape with bohemian roots. SoHo is a hub of art galleries, boutique shops, and stylish cafes—a hotspot for both locals and visitors seeking creative inspiration. TriBeCa (short for “Triangle Below Canal Street”) is now famous for its trendy eateries, chic shops, and its annual film festival.

Your guide might share stories about the neighborhoods’ evolution from industrial zones to fashionable districts, adding depth to your visual experience.
